New Airport In Istanbul

The Council of Ministers stated that Ataturk Airport was inadequate in certain ways, so a new airport was needed. In 2018, Istanbul Airport opened to the public. Since Ataturk Airport shut down, it has served as the sole airport on Istanbul’s European side.

Istanbul Airport is designed as more than just a place to catch a flight. The airport includes hotels, apartments, commercial facilities, a hospital, a library, a museum, a cultural center, and even a carnival. There is also a children’s playground in the airside departures area, making it a practical stop for families as well as solo travelers.

New Airport in Istanbul: Terminal and Flight Procedures

Through its massive terminal, Istanbul Airport serves both domestic and international passengers. The station can be accessed through seven different gates. There are more than 500 counters available for check-in and baggage procedures, and international flights are supported by 228 passport control points.

Because of the airport’s size, it is recommended that you arrive at least 3 hours before your flight to stay on the safe side. If you arrive early, you can make good use of your time by relaxing in one of the cafés or spending quiet moments in the library.

How to Get to the New Airport

The new airport is located in Arnavutkoy on Istanbul’s European side. You can reach it by taxi, private car, or bus. There are also companies offering special transportation services for travelers who want a more direct transfer.

Taksim Square, one of Istanbul’s most visited areas, is about 40 kilometers away. If you prefer driving, the airport offers extensive parking facilities, along with car wash and fuel station services.

For current public transportation details, route updates, and official service information, it is best to check IETT and Metro Istanbul before you travel.

Shopping and Dining in Istanbul Airport

One of the most enjoyable parts of spending time at the airport is the wide range of dining and shopping options. At Istanbul Airport, you can choose from 150 food and beverage points prepared for travelers. These include coffee chains, cafés, restaurants, buffets, and fast-food options, especially in the international departures areas.

The airport also has exhibition spaces worth seeing while you wait. You can visit the photography exhibition of Ara Guler, the famous photographer known as “the Eye of Istanbul.” There is also a Victory Monument Exhibition that presents the airport’s development.

Shopping choices are equally extensive. International departures include many duty-free stores, while domestic areas also feature cosmetic and clothing shops. Pharmacies and bookshops add to the convenience. If you have a layover or arrive early, the airport offers enough variety to make your waiting time feel more like time spent in a shopping center.

In 3rd of November, 1947, Turkey’s then-president İsmet İnönü inaugurated the stadium, who was also a Beşiktaş fan. The initial viewer capacity of the İnönü Stadium was 16,000 people. In 1952, it was renamed as the Mithat Paşa Stadium, though this was reversed later in 1973. It is also worth mentioning that because of the unique location of the stadium, it had a legal status as a "historic monument", which is protected by the Turkish High Council of Monuments.
